Under the vehicle, drivers side.
1.. Disconnect negative cable from remote jumper terminal.
2.. Drain cooling system
3.. Remove the engine oil dipstick and tube. To prevent coolant from
entering engine, cover the dipstick tube opening in crankcase with a
suitable plug.
4.. Raise vehicle on hoist.
5.. Support the engine and remove the left engine mount
6.. Remove generator support strut.
7.. Disconnect generator electrical connector.
8.. Remove the transaxle dipstick tube bracket attaching bolt.
9.. Remove the lower heater hose tube bracket bolt.
10.. Remove the lower heater hose from thermostat housing.
11.. Remove radiator lower hose from thermostat housing.
12.. Remove thermostat housing bolts
13.. Remove thermostat and housing.

The transmission control unit is located between the engine oil dipstick and the windshield washer fluid reservoir on the 2002 Dodge Intrepid. The TCM and PCM are one built into one unit on 2002 models.
There are four oxygen sensors on a 2002 Intrepid. There is one before, and one after the catalytic converter on each side of the engine.
